I tried it with hose in front of the canister and the clearance between the can and belt was much less. I even thought of trimming the rubber hose that connects the canister to the 90 degree fitting so it would pull it closer to the center of the elbow. Having the can outside the hose and the fitting turned towards the air filter as much as possible seems to give the most clearance.
